Definitions:

Gestalt

A psychological theory that proposes objects are viewed holistically rather than as a collection of individual parts, emphasizing the mind's innate tendency to organize perceptions.

Phenomenon

an observable event or fact, particularly extraordinary or remarkable, that can be scientifically described or explained.

Phi Phenomenon

The optical illusion of perceiving continuous motion between separate objects viewed in rapid succession.

Gestalt Psychology

A psychological approach that emphasizes the holistic and intrinsic properties of the mind's perception of the world, suggesting that the whole of anything is greater than its parts.
